How to Make a BBQ Chicken Sandwich with Avocado Sauce
Place the chicken in a large pot and fill it with water or chicken stock. Bring it to a boil over high heat.
Once boiling, reduce the heat cover and reduce to a simmer. Simmer the chicken for 10-15 minutes until the chicken reaches 165 degrees.
Using tongs, remove the chicken and set it aside on a plate. When it has cooled enough to touch, shred the chicken.
In a bowl, combine the cooked chicken and BBQ sauce. Coat the chicken evenly.
Then make the spicy Jalapeno Avocado Spread.
Combine the ingredients together in a food processor and blend it smooth.
Make the sandwiches by placing a heaping 1/2 cup on each bottom bun. Spread the Avocado spread evenly over the top bun and then put the top on the sandwich.
BBQ Chicken Sandwiches with Spicy Avocado Spread
Ingredients
- 1 pound boneless skinless chicken breasts
- ½ cup low-sugar BBQ sauce
- 4 whole wheat buns
- For the Spicy Jalapeño Avocado Spread:
- 1 avocado pitted
- 1 small jalapeño seeded and diced (keep the seeds for more heat)
- juice of ½ a lime about 1 tablespoon
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
Optional*:
- lettuce
- tomato
- thin-sliced provolone cheese
Instructions
- Place the chicken in a pot large enough to hold it all, and fill the pot with enough water (or chicken stock) to cover the chicken by about 1-2 inches. Bring to a boil over high heat.
- When the water comes to a boil, cover the pot with a lid and reduce the heat to low. Simmer the chicken for 10-15 minutes, or until the internal temperature of the thickest part of the breast reads 165 ℉.
- Using tongs, remove the chicken and reserve on a plate. When it is cool enough to touch, shred it and set aside.
- In a medium mixing bowl, combine the cooked chicken and BBQ sauce together, tossing with tongs to evenly coat.
- To prepare the Spicy Jalapeño Avocado Spread: combine all of the ingredients together in a food processor and blend until smooth.
- To assemble the sandwiches: place about a heaping ½ cup on each bottom bun and evenly spread the Jalapeño Avocado Spread on each top bun, then sandwich together.
